Totally asymmetric simple exclusion process on a periodic lattice with Langmuir kinetics depending on the occupancy of the forward neighboring site

Abstract: Abstract We generalize the totally asymmetric simple exclusion process with Langmuir kinetics on a periodic lattice. In the extended model, the rates of attachment and detachment depend on the occupancy of the forward neighboring site. Using a mean-field theory, we obtain the analytical expression of the density profile in the steady state and the relaxation dynamics in our model. We verify their accuracy by comparing the results with Monte Carlo simulations.
